Come verificare se un numero e primo in C++?

Domanda di: Evangelista Piras  |  Ultimo aggiornamento: 3 agosto 2022
Valutazione: 4.6/5 (5 voti)

Un numero è primo quando ha come divisore uno e se stesso. Quindi è primo ciascun numero naturale maggiore di 1 che sia divisibile solamente per 1 e per sé stesso. La successione dei numeri primi comincia con 2, 3, 5, 7, 11, 13, 17, 19, 23, 29, 31, …

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su codingcreativo.it

Come vedere se un numero è primo algoritmo?

Lo pseudocodice dell'algoritmo
  1. class primo(n) {
  2. # non è un numero primo se.
  3. if n<2 return false.
  4. if n%2=0 return false.
  5. if n%3=0 return false.
  6. # è un numero primo se 2 o 3.
  7. if (n=2) o (n=3) return true.
  8. #dividi il numero per i numeri dispari da 3 in poi fino alla radice quadrata di n.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su andreaminini.com

Come trovare i numeri primi in C++?

Dando per scontato che tutti i numeri sono divisibili per 1 la variabile i già dal primo giro nel ciclo do-while viene posta a 2 , si divide n per i e si controlla il resto posto nella variabile x: si esce dal ciclo do-while solo se i è un divisore di n, se n è un numero primo, risulterà essere i=n.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su edutecnica.it

Quando si dice che un numero è primo?

numero primo numero intero maggiore di 1 che ammette solo divisori banali, cioè 1 e sé stesso.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su treccani.it

Quali sono i numeri primi da 0 a 100?

Alla fine del lavoro, i numeri cerchiati sono i numeri primi entro il 100: 2, 3, 5, 7, 11, 13, 17, 19, 23, 29, 31, 37, 41, 43, 47, 53, 59, 61, 67, 71, 73, 79, 83, 89, 97.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su mat.uniroma2.it

Programmazione C++: Numero primo



Trovate 33 domande correlate

Quali sono tutti i numeri primi?

2, 3, 5, 7, 11, 13, 17, 19, 23, 29: sono tutti divisibili solo per 1 e per sé stessi. Un numero maggiore di 1 ma con più di due numeri divisori è detto invece composto. Per esempio: 2, 3 e 5 sono primi, mentre 4 e 6 non lo sono. Infatti, il 4 è divisibile per 1 e per sé stesso ma anche per 2 .

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su focusjunior.it

Perché il 3 e un numero primo?

Sono i mattoni della matematica

Per esempio, 2, 3 e 5 sono primi, mentre 4 e 6 non lo sono perché sono divisibili rispettivamente anche per 2 e per 2 e 3. C'è solo un numero primo pari ed è 2, perché tutti gli altri numeri pari sono divisibili per 2. Gli altri numeri primi sono tutti dispari.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su ansa.it

Quali sono i numeri che non sono primi?

In effetti, su alcuni testi si trova la definizione di numero primo nella forma (equivalente alla nostra): Un intero n≥2 si dice primo se è divisibile solo per 1 e per sé stesso. Sono dunque primi i numeri 2, 3, 5, 7, 11, 13, . . . , mentre non sono primi i numeri 4, 6, 8, 9, 10, 12, 14, 15, 16, . . . .

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su studenti.it

Che numero e 1?

In base alla definizione elementare di numero primo riportata da alcuni testi e dizionari (un numero che ha come fattori solo 1 e se stesso) 1 sarebbe indiscutibilmente primo.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su crittologia.eu

Come si scrive un numero primo?

Definizione. Numero Primo: un numero primo n è un numero naturale maggiore di 1 (n>1) se n ammette come divisori solamente 1 e se stesso. Ricordiamo che un numero naturale a è divisore di un altro numero naturale b se b:a (b diviso a) ha resto 0. Spesso si scrive a|b e si legge a divide b.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su sanmicheli.edu.it

Come si fa a vedere se un numero è primo in Java?

num/2) .
  1. Se num è divisibile, flag è impostato su true e interrompiamo il ciclo. Ciò determina che num non è un numero primo.
  2. Se num non è divisibile per alcun numero, flag è falso e num è un numero primo.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su it.wiki-base.com

Come si usa il crivello di Eratostene?

Il Crivello di Eratostene

Eliminiamo il numero 1, che per definizione non è primo; poi evidenziamo il numero 2 (che sarà un numero primo) ed eliminiamo tutti i numeri multipli di 2 (diversi da 2).

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su mat.uniroma1.it

Perché il numero 1 non e un numero primo?

1 non viene considerato primo perchè senno non varrebbe il teorema fondamentale dell'aritmetica (in particolare l'unicità della fattorizzazione), infatti 1*2*5=1*1*2*3*5 (ad esempio).

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su oliforum.it

Quali sono i numeri primi e perché si chiamano così?

I numeri primi si chiamano così e devono la loro denominazione al fatto che sono la base di tutti gli altri numeri. Abbiamo visto, infatti, che non possono essere divisi per nessun altro numero che sia 1 o se stessi, ovviamente rimanendo sempre all'interno dei numeri reali.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su sololibri.net

Perché 0 e 1 non sono numeri primi?

In particolare, 0 non è primo perché è divisibile per infiniti numeri, oltre a se stesso; 1 non è primo perché … ha un solo divisore, se stesso. 2 è il primo numero primo… ed è l'unico numero primo pari! Infatti i numeri pari maggiori di 2 sono divisibili per 2 e quindi composti!

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su blog.redooc.com

Perché il 7 e un numero primo?

Esempio. 7 essendo divisibile solamente per 1 e 7 è un numero primo, mentre 14 essendo divisibile per 1, 2 e 7 è un numero composto.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su skuola.net

Quali sono i numeri primi da 1 a 20?

La successione dei numeri primi comincia con 2, 3, 5, 7, 11, 13, 17, 19, 23, 29, 31, 37…

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su it.wikipedia.org

Quali sono i numeri primi da 1 a 200?

Osserviamo i numeri primi da 100 a 200: 101, 103, 107, 109, 113, 119, 127, 131, 137, 139, 149, 151, 157, 163, 167, 173, 179, 181, 191, 193, 197, 199 Quanti sono i numeri primi Page 31 Possono esserci lacune molto grandi, come, ad esempio, cinquantamila numeri successivi fra i quali non ci sia neppure un numero primo?

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su campusmfs.it

Perché 2 7 13 19 23 sono numeri primi?

Il numero 2 è primo, dato che ha esattamente due divisori, 1 e 2, ed è l'unico primo che è anche pari. Il numero 3 è primo, dato che ha esattamente due divisori: 1 e 3. I primi numeri primi, nell'ordine, sono 2, 3, 5, 7, 11, 13, 17, 19, 23 ecc.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su mama.edu.ti.ch

Qual e il numero primo più piccolo?

Breve storia della primalità di 1

Cari colleghi docenti di matematica, noi tutti insegniamo che il più piccolo numero primo è 2 e spieghiamo perché non conviene considerare 1 come numero primo.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su utenti.quipo.it

Qual e il numero primo più grande?

Il più grande numero primo conosciuto è, a marzo 2022, 282 589 933 − 1, un numero che, se scritto in base 10, è composto da 24 862 048 cifre. Tale numero è stato scoperto il 7 dicembre 2018 da Patrick Laroche nell'ambito del progetto Great Internet Mersenne Prime Search (GIMPS).

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su it.wikipedia.org

Che cos'e il Crivello?

Il crivello è uno strumento formato da un setaccio oscillante o rotante, dotato di maglie più o meno fini.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su it.wikipedia.org

Perché si chiama crivello di Eratostene?

Il crivello di Eratostene è un antico algoritmo per il calcolo delle tabelle di numeri primi fino a un certo numero prefissato. Questo principio deve il proprio nome al matematico Eratostene di Cirene, che ne fu l'ideatore.

Richiesta di rimozione della fonte   |   Visualizza la risposta completa su it.wikipedia.org
Articolo precedente
Quanto costa pubblicare su OpenSea?
Articolo successivo
Come riconoscere l'oro fai da te?